Toronto, CANADA – February 26, 2015 – Independent game design team Blue Isle Studios announced today that the survival horror Slender: The Arrival is coming on March 24 to PlayStation®4, the computer entertainment system, and on March 25 to Xbox One, the all-in-one games and entertainment system from Microsoft via the ID@Xbox self-publishing program. The official video game adaptation of the internet phenomenon, Slender: The Arrival will send the most fearless gamers into panic as they unfold the twisted mystery in a dark, foreboding atmosphere and a story fraught with terror, paranoia and other-worldly forces.

Based on eye-witness accounts, The Slender Man is depicted as a thin, unnaturally tall man dressed in a black suit with a blank, featureless face. Now Slender: The Arrival comes to next-gen consoles with brand new story elements and extended levels that continue to unfold the Slender Man mythos. Players are enveloped in a world of sensory deprivation filled with haunting visions and audio cues that create a healthy dose of tension and paranoia.

In The Arrival’s all new storyline, Lauren is in search of her friend Kate, who recently has become increasingly obsessed with the folklore of Slender Man. Was Kate’s disappearance the work of Slender Man?  Use Kate’s forgotten flashlight to explore abandoned houses, creepy mines and dark forests to unravel the mystery – all the while being stalked by the menacing presence of Slender Man.

Developed in collaboration with Eric “Victor Surge” Knudson, creator of the paranormal phenomenon, and written by the creative team behind the Marble Hornets series, Slender: The Arrival is rated ‘T’ for Teen (Blood, Violence) and will release for $9.99 digital download on March 24 for PlayStation®4 and March 25 in the Xbox Games Store for Xbox One.

Blue Isle Studios is hiring, again!

We are looking for a skilled programmer to help us out with our brand new game; a first person exploration and adventure featuring beautiful outdoor worlds. The ideal candidate is able to work closely with design to develop some of the best quality features for players on all kinds of platforms ranging from PC to consoles, and mobile. Most importantly, we are looking for someone who is genuinely passionate and excited to create amazing video game experiences.

This is a full-time position working from our office located in downtown Toronto. We are not looking for remote contract work at this time.

The role will primarily consist of design and implementation of various gameplay systems. We are looking for someone that is comfortable working closely with designers to create compelling gameplay as well as improve on their world building workflows. Experience working within Unity as well as utilizing Unity’s new GUI tools are a requirement. Our ideal candidate has at least 3 years of experience and has shipped a PC or console game in the past.

From a technical standpoint we’re looking for someone that can work within the constraints and tools provided; this means that the right candidate can create major systems in Unity without relying on external plugins or assets. The right candidate would have experience with various systems such as AI/Pathing, gameplay scripting, FX and database management. Intimate knowledge of C# is a must while C/C++ programming would be viewed as a plus. Additional assets that are not requirements include network programming experience, mathematics skills including trigonometry and linear algebra, experience with multithreaded code, knowledge of Shaderlab/CGProgram/HLSL and knowledge of Linux/SSH/PHP/HTML or other web technologies.

Being a small independent studio, this position means that you will have the opportunity to work very closely with the rest of our team. If you are interested in working with us to help create memorable gameplay experiences for years to come, we’d love to hear from you.
